Hi All.

Me and my fiance are getting married here in England next April 24th. We are booked in for our Disney World honeymoon arriving on the 26th for 13 nights. We have 5 nights booked in at Port Orleans French Quarter. An then as a new DVC resale member will book 8 nights over at the Animal Kingdom Lodge in a studio, Savannah view (once we get our welcome letter in a few weeks).

My questions are:
1. Should I keep the Animal Kingdom Lodge or if possible to get the boardwalk at our 7 months window book there? If at the Boardwalk it's likely to be a 1 bedroom rather than studio. (I don't mind using 2 years of points for this as I will have 2019 and 2020 points available). We have stayed Animal Kingdom Lodge Savannah view before and also at the Poly.

2. Over the course of the honeymoon what do people recommend doing that can make our trip different than our usual Disney trips. We will have the Dining Plan for our stay, also we did the Key to the Kingdom tour this year so if doing a tour what other option would you go for?

Thanks in advance.

We had our Honeymoon last September and stayed Savannah View in the Jambo House for 11 nights. We loved it! The resort is beautiful and peaceful. It was our 1st choice as it was something new for us.

I don't think you can go wrong with either BWV or AKL. If you want to try something new go for BWV. I love the location and that you can walk to both Epcot and HS. I also like that you can enjoy restaurants at nearby YC, BC, Swan and Dolphin. The Boardwalk also offers a bit more entertainment and evening activities than AKL does.

I'm not very familiar with DVC ownership - could you book AKL as a back up at your 11 months and then try and change to BWVs at the 7 month mark?

As a DVC owner I would tell you book your home resort to make sure you HAVE the dates you want. Then at the 7 month mark you can actual book and switch. This way you can have the dates you want and then move the the resort you want if it's available.
 
I'm not a fan of the Boardwalk but it is closer to the parks. If you will go to Epcot and DHS often, you might want to switch. But, I really like AKL more.
 


AKL was nice because it felt away from the hussle of the parks. The only issue I experienced was not due to the resort, but had I known how far down I would have to walk 5 months after foot/ankle surgery I think I would have booked copper creek that year.
